在数学、物理学、生物学以及日常生活的诸多领域,连环链条的概念无处不在。它们以不同的形式出现,发挥着各自独特的功能。本文将带您从一环到百环,深入了解连环链条的奥秘及其在现实世界中的应用。
一、连环链条的起源与发展
连环链条,又称环形结构,最早可追溯到古代人类对自然界的观察。例如,在古希腊时期,人们发现水分子呈环形结构,从而推测出连环链条的存在。随着科学的发展,连环链条的概念逐渐被数学家、物理学家和生物学家所关注。
1. 数学中的连环链条
在数学领域,连环链条主要指的是环状结构。例如,拓扑学中的环面、环空间等都是连环链条的典型代表。这些结构在解决几何问题、分析拓扑变换等方面具有重要意义。
2. 物理学中的连环链条
在物理学中,连环链条主要表现为分子间的作用力。例如,氢键、范德华力等都是分子间连环链条的体现。这些力在物质的结构、性质和功能中发挥着关键作用。
3. 生物学中的连环链条
在生物学中,连环链条主要指生物体内的分子结构。例如,蛋白质、核酸等生物大分子都是由连环链条组成的。这些分子结构在遗传、代谢、免疫等生物过程中发挥着重要作用。
二、连环链条的实际应用
连环链条在现实世界中有着广泛的应用,以下列举几个典型案例:
1. 材料科学
连环链条在材料科学中的应用尤为突出。例如,碳纳米管、石墨烯等新型材料都是由碳原子组成的连环链条结构。这些材料具有优异的力学性能、导电性和热稳定性,在航空航天、电子信息等领域具有广泛的应用前景。
# 举例:碳纳米管的合成过程
def carbon_nanotube_synthesis():
# 定义碳纳米管的基本结构
carbon_structure = "C6-C6-C6-C6-C6-C6" # 6个碳原子组成的六元环
# 合成碳纳米管
nanotube = carbon_structure * 1000 # 1000个六元环组成的碳纳米管
return nanotube
# 调用函数,展示碳纳米管的合成过程
print(carbon_nanotube_synthesis())
2. 信息技术
连环链条在信息技术中的应用也非常广泛。例如,区块链技术就是基于连环链条的原理。区块链通过将数据记录在一系列相互连接的区块中,实现了数据的不可篡改和安全性。
# 举例:区块链技术的基本原理
def blockchain():
# 定义区块结构
block = {
"index": 1,
"timestamp": "2023-01-01",
"data": "这是一条记录",
"prev_hash": "previous_hash_value"
}
# 生成区块
new_block = {
"index": block["index"] + 1,
"timestamp": "2023-01-02",
"data": "这是第二条记录",
"prev_hash": calculate_hash(block)
}
return new_block
# 定义计算哈希函数
def calculate_hash(block):
# 对区块数据进行哈希运算
hash_value = hashlib.sha256(str(block).encode()).hexdigest()
return hash_value
# 调用函数,展示区块链的基本原理
print(blockchain())
3. 生物医学
在生物医学领域,连环链条在药物设计、基因编辑等方面发挥着重要作用。例如,基于连环链条原理的药物靶点识别技术可以帮助科学家找到更有效的药物。
三、结论
连环链条作为一种重要的结构形式,在数学、物理学、生物学和现实世界中的应用日益广泛。了解连环链条的奥秘,有助于我们更好地认识世界、解决问题。在未来,随着科技的不断发展,连环链条将在更多领域发挥重要作用。
